Section 14 (Cooling): Radiator: Removal

  1. REMOVE COOL AIR INTAKE DUCT SEAL  (See REMOVAL )
  2. REMOVE ENGINE ROOM SIDE COVER LH  (See REMOVAL )
  3. REMOVE ENGINE ROOM SIDE COVER RH  (See REMOVAL )
  4. REMOVE V-BANK COVER SUB-ASSEMBLY  (See REMOVAL )
  5. REMOVE NO. 1 AIR CLEANER INLET  (See REMOVAL )
  6. REMOVE AIR CLEANER CAP SUB-ASSEMBLY  (See REMOVAL )
  7. REMOVE ENGINE UNDER COVER 
  8. REMOVE NO. 2 ENGINE UNDER COVER 
  9. DRAIN A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SION FLUID  (See REMOVAL )
  10. DRAIN ENGINE COOLANT  (See COOLANT )
  11. REMOVE RADIATOR GRILLE PROTECTOR  (See REMOVAL )
  12. REMOVE FRONT BUMPER ASSEMBLY  (See REMOVAL )
  13. REMOVE FRONT BUMPER ENERGY ABSORBER  (See DISASSEMBLY )
  14. REMOVE RADIATOR SUPPORT OPENING COVER (See  REMOVAL  ) 
  15. REMOVE MILLIMETER WAVE RADAR SENSOR ASSEMBLY (w/ Dynamic Radar Cruise Control System)  (See REMOVAL )
  16. REMOVE HOOD LOCK CONTROL CABLE COVER  (See REMOVAL )
  17. REMOVE HOOD LOCK NUT CAP  (See REMOVAL )
  18. DISCONNECT HOOD LOCK ASSEMBLY  (See REMOVAL )
  19. REMOVE RADIATOR RESERVE TANK ASSEMBLY 
    1. Disconnect 2 reserve tank hoses, then remove the 2 bolts and radiator reserve tank assembly.

  20. REMOVE ENGINE ROOM ECU OUTLET DUCT 
    1. Remove the engine room ECU outlet duct from the engine room ECU box

  21. REMOVE UPPER RADIATOR SUPPORT 
    1. Disconnect the smog ventilation sensor connector.

    2. Disconnect the 2 horn connectors

    3. Separate the 5 clamps and the wire harness from the upper radiator support.

    4. Separate the 2 clamps and the wire harness from the upper radiator support.

    5. Separate the 3 clamps and the wire harness from the fan shroud.

    6. Disconnect the 2 cooling fan ECU connectors

    7. Remove the 5 bolts and the upper radiator support

  22. DISCONNECT NO. 1 RADIATOR HOSE 
    1. Disconnect the No 1 radiator hose from the radiator assembly.

  23. DISCONNECT NO. 2 RADIATOR HOSE 
    1. Disconnect the No. 2 radiator hose from the radiator assembly.

  24. DISCONNECT OIL COOLER HOSE 
    1. Disconnect the 2 oil cooler hoses from the radiator assembly
    2. Disconnect the 2 bolts and oil cooler pipe from the radiator assembly.

  25. SEPARATE COOLER CONDENSER ASSEMBLY 
    1. Remove the 4 bolts and separate the cooler condenser assembly from the radiator assembly

  26. REMOVE RADIATOR ASSEMBLY 
    1. Remove the radiator assembly from the vehicle together with the cooling fan assembly
      NOTE: Make sure that the cooler condenser assembly and radiator assembly do not come into contact with each other.

    2. Remove the 2 bolts.
    3. Release the claw and lift the fan assembly from the radiator assembly.

  27. REMOVE RADIATOR SUPPORT CUSHION 
    1. Remove the 2 radiator support cushions.

  28. REMOVE LOWER RADIATOR SUPPORT 
    1. Remove the 2 lower radiator supports.
